June 30, 2006
Leesburg -- A man who's been in jail since a deadly wreck Wednesday night is now charged with three counts of vehicular homicide.
State Troopers also charged 38-year old Michael Littleton with DUI and serious injury of a person by vehicle.
This isn't Littleton's first DUI arrest. In 1995, he pleaded guilty to DUI in Dougherty County. In 1997 he entered a nolo plea and was sentenced to one year probation and fined $400.
Troopers say bout 9:00 Wednesday night, Littleton lost control of his Ford pickup on Ledo Road at Hugh Road and crashed head on into a 1988 Pontiac Sunbird. Forty-one-year-old Kelly Jean Caldwell and her husband, 36-year-old Charles Caldwell were killed.
Six-year-old Dylan Eurell was critically injured and remains in Egleston Hospital in Atlanta.
A passenger in Littleton's truck, 17-year-old Nathaniel Wood, was also killed. Littleton is being held at the Lee County jail without bond.
